Are people in Alderton older or younger than people in Salt Lake City?
- The Median Age in Alderton is 14.7 years older than in Salt Lake City.

Are housing costs cheaper in Alderton or Salt Lake City?
- Alderton housing costs are 24.0% less expensive than Salt Lake City hous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Alderton or Salt Lake City?
- The average commute for residents of Alderton is 15.2 minutes longer than it is for residents of Salt Lake City.

Things to do in Salt Lake City?
Salt Lake City, Utah is a vibrant city with plenty of attractions for everyone. Nature lovers can explore the scenic Great Salt Lake or take a hike in the Wasatch Mountains. History buffs should check out sites like Temple Square and This Is The Place Heritage Park to learn more about the area's past. Sports fans can catch a game at Salt Palace Convention Center, while foodies can sample all kinds of delicious eats throughout town. Shopping lovers should head to City Creek Mall or Gateway Mall for good deals on all kinds of items. With its endless outdoor activities and lively nightlife, Salt Lake City is an amazing place to visit!

Things to do in Alderton?
Living in Alderton, WA is a great experience. The town is small but has plenty of things for residents to do and see. Located in the foothills of the Cascade Mountains, Alderton is full of natural beauty with lush forests, rolling hills, and crystal clear rivers. The people here are friendly and welcoming, creating a strong sense of community that makes living here even more enjoyable. With its convenient location close to larger cities like Seattle and Tacoma, Alderton provides easy access to essential amenities while also allowing its citizens to escape the hustle and bustle of city life when they want to. All in all, Alderton is an ideal place to live for those seeking an outdoor lifestyle with friendly neighbors.
